Message from President Theresa
Hello, friends! We're moving into one of my favorite seasons, Springtime! The season of renewal, blossoming flowers, and new beginnings. There's something incredibly inspiring about this time of year that encourages personal growth and transformation. Here are some ways to embrace springtime for your personal growth journey:
| |
|
1. Reflect and Set Goals: Take some time to reflect on your accomplishments and areas for improvement. Set new goals for yourself, whether they’re related to your career, health, or personal development.
2. Get Outdoors: Spending time in nature can do wonders for your mental well-being. Take a walk in the park, go hiking, or simply enjoy the beauty of blooming flowers and fresh air.
3. Practice Mindfulness: Spring is a great time to practice mindfulness and be present in the moment. Try meditation, deep breathing exercises, or yoga to help you stay centered and focused.
4. Declutter and Organize: Spring cleaning isn’t just for your home. Decluttering your physical space can lead to a clearer mind and a more organized life. Donate items you no longer need and create a fresh, clean environment.
| | |
5. Learn Something New: Embrace the season of growth by learning a new skill or hobby. Whether it’s gardening, painting, or learning a new language, challenging yourself can lead to personal growth and satisfaction.
6. Connect with Others: Strengthen your relationships by spending quality time with friends and family. Plan a picnic, attend local events, or simply catch up over a cup of coffee.
7. Focus on Health: Spring is the perfect time to rejuvenate your body. Start a new exercise routine, try out healthy recipes with seasonal produce, and prioritize self-care.
Here’s to a season of growth, renewal, and blossoming into the best version of yourself!

Live Your Dream Awards Progam 3-12-25 | |
Soroptimist's Live Your Dream Awards program is a unique education award for women who provide the primary financial support for their families. The Live Your Dream Awards give women the resources they need to improve their education, skills and employment prospects. | |
